Why Advertising Transparency Matters
Advertising transparency refers to the clarity and openness with which companies communicate their advertising practices, intentions, and processes. Here are several reasons why it is vital:
- Increased Consumer Trust: Transparency helps consumers feel secure in their purchasing decisions, knowing exactly what they’re buying and the intentions behind marketing campaigns.
- Reduced Skepticism: Open communication about advertising methods can reduce marketing skepticism. When consumers understand how their data is used, they're more likely to feel positive about a brand.
- Enhanced Brand Loyalty: Brands that prioritize transparency are more likely to develop loyal customers who appreciate a straightforward approach.
How Advertising Transparency Influences Consumer Behavior
Studies show that consumers are increasingly willing to support brands that are transparent in their business practices. Here’s how it influences their behavior:
- Informed Decisions: Transparent advertising allows consumers to make informed choices based on honest information rather than exaggerated claims.
- Shared Values: Consumers gravitate towards brands that align with their personal values and ethics. Transparency in advertising highlights these shared values, strengthening the brand-consumer relationship.
- Word-of-Mouth Recommendations: Satisfied customers who trust a brand due to its transparency are more likely to recommend it to others, generating positive referrals.
Strategies for Achieving Advertising Transparency
Here are effective strategies businesses can implement to enhance transparency:
- Clear Messaging: Ensure that all marketing messages are straightforward and truthful. Avoid ambiguous language that may confuse consumers.
- Data Privacy Practices: Be upfront about how consumer data is collected, stored, and used. Make privacy policies easily accessible.
- Showcase Authentic Reviews: Display customer feedback and testimonials transparently. Allow potential customers to see honest opinions about products and services.
